RE Salesperson License requirements? - ANS 18 years old, 40 hour class, pass the exam, must
affiliate with a broker to practice and may not accept direct client payments


Broker's License requirements? - ANS 3 years salesperson experience, 40 hour class, pass the
exam, $5,000 bond and pay a fee.


What is MLS? - ANS Multiple Listing Service. It's a marketing tool used by Salespeople to
show their listings.


Difference between RE Salesperson and RE Broker? - ANS Salesperson works for a Broker.
Broker has at least 3 years experience, $5,000 Bond, 40 Hour Class and pass the Exam. Cannot
hold both licenses at the same time. Broker can operate independently, accept direct client
payments and handle Escrow Funds.


Define Realtor? - ANS It is National, not state and is optional. NAR (National Assoc. of
Realtors) Largest Trade Assoc. and one of the most powerful lobbying groups in North America.
Pay a fee to join your local chapter (MAR).
Also, if a Broker is a Realtor, all Salespeople/Agents associated with the office must be Realtors
as well.

,What is an Escrow Fund/Trust Accounts? - ANS 1. Special bank accounts for holding Client's
deposits to be handled by Broker only. 2. Brokers may have only one Escrow account.
3. Commingling is strictly forbidden.
4. No Salesperson Access.
5. Interest not mandatory but if yes the client must agree who gets it in writing. (Statute of
Fraud)
6. Brokers must maintain Escrow Records (copies of checks, dates, transaction info) for 3 years
which the RE Board may inspect at any time.
7. Conversion of a deposit into commission requires written permission from both parties. If
not, can result in loss of license.
8. Court order needed to remove funds if there is a dispute.


State Law -v- Federal Law? - ANS Fed=US/State=Massachusetts State law builds on Fed law
and is more specific. In a conflict, Fed law usually wins.


Who needs a RE License? - ANS Anyone who does any of the following for a fee: Advertises,
holds herself out as engaged in the biz of selling, renting, leasing, negotiation, exchanging,
purchasing and dealing in RE or options for RE.


Where do licenses come from? - ANS State Legislature creates the laws about licenses. The
Board of Registration of RE & Salespersons deals with issuing licenses and rule administration
and enforcement. The Board is part of the Division of Professional Licensure.


Why do we have licenses? - ANS To protect the public, for the public good. Much of the
Government's ability to regulate private transactions stems from Police Power which is the right
of the Gov to enact laws to protect the public.


Who makes up the Board of Registration of RE & Salespersons? - ANS - 5 Member Board est.
in 1960
- Appointed by the Governor
- One is appointed Chairperson
- 3 are Brokers with at least 7 years experience

,- 2 are not licensed, represent the public
- 5 year terms, no pay
- Meet 4 times a year with at least 3 of the Members present. Written records of meetings are
available to the public on Division of Pro Licensure's website


1099 -v- W2 Employee? - ANS 1099=Independent Contractor, paid by job or commission, set
own hours, can turn down work, etc, no taxes withheld, but may take many write-offs (Many
Residential RE Agents)


W2=Salaried of paid hourly, employer controls what and how you do (Commercial RE Agents),
taxes withheld by employers


What is FSBO? - ANS For Sale by Owner


Types of RE Advertising? - ANS MLS, Open House, Trulia, Zillow, Neighbors, etc.


Define Qualified Buyer? - ANS Client who is ready, willing and able!


What is the average commission? - ANS NONE - ALWAYS NEGOTIABLE!!!!!


What is the basic RE Transaction? - ANS - Hired to list property
- Market/list on MLS, etc
- Buyer's contact you to see
- Show the property
- Offer submitted
- Inspection
- Contingencies
- Creation and signing of P&S, 5% of Sales Price is Deposited in Escrow Account. Finance
Contingencies apply here as well.
- Sale takes place (settlement/closing)

Rental commissions? - ANS Up to one month's rent


How often are RE Licenses renewed? - ANS 2 years from you next birthday. 12 hours of
Continuing Ed Classes must be completed before renewal.


What are the two types of Insurance carried by Brokers? - ANS Professional Liability
Insurance (errors and omissions insurance)-Provides protection against mistakes made by
Brokers or Salespersons providing RE Services to their clients. Human and Innocent mistakes
happen...


General Liability Insurance


Principal, Special Agent, Subagent? - ANS Principal=Client, hires Special Agent


Special Agent=Broker, hired and paid by Principal directly


Subagent(Agent's Agent)=Salesperson/Agent Broker pays you as a subagent working on their
behalf. You will be client's subagent and the Broker's agent


What is Real Property? - ANS The land, anything attached to the land, and all of the various
rights associated with ownership of the land. aka: Real Estate(just the land and property
attached) , Realty or Immovable Property.


What is Personal Property? - ANS Anything not attached to the Land or improvements on the
land. aka chattel or moveable property.


What is a Deed? - ANS Receipt for Real Estate. Ownership of property is
transferred/conveyed using a deed.
